Output eb203d7adacc32fdc765efcdc7120e5ff36874622fa86b9a235745e91f0d4016:1

value
43807763
script pubkey
OP_0 OP_PUSHBYTES_20 3515592557e8e339d91bc021b866419f9d571589
address
ltc1qx524jf2har3nnkgmcqsmsejpn7w4w9vfmxfmqf
transaction
eb203d7adacc32fdc765efcdc7120e5ff36874622fa86b9a235745e91f0d4016
spent
true